Address 0 PPC

PEu9vSKFhbNyWhBiJ81rSMrCu11UCGBvau

Confirmed

Total Received40.039442 PPC
Total Sent40.039442 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.00587 PPC
17235 Confirmations79.146958 PPC
Fee: 0.00485 PPC
17247 Confirmations122.176764 PPC